The purpose of applying a skim coat to stucco surfaces is to create a smooth and uniform finish, covering any imperfections or uneven areas in the stucco. This helps improve the appearance of the surface and provides a better base for painting or other decorative finishes.

How to stucco over plywood effectively?

To stucco over plywood effectively, first ensure the plywood is clean and dry. Apply a bonding agent to the surface, then mix and apply a scratch coat of stucco. Once the scratch coat has set, apply a finish coat of stucco. Allow the stucco to cure properly before painting or sealing it.

How to texture stucco for a professional finish?

To texture stucco for a professional finish, follow these steps: Prepare the surface by cleaning and repairing any cracks or imperfections. Apply a base coat of stucco evenly across the surface. Use a trowel or other texturing tool to create the desired texture, such as a swirl or stipple pattern. Allow the stucco to partially dry before using a float or sponge to further refine the texture. Finish by applying a top coat of stucco for added durability and a polished look. By following these steps carefully and practicing your technique, you can achieve a professional finish on your stucco texture.

What is the base coat of stucco called?

It is sometimes referred to as a 'scratch coat' or 'parge' or 'pargeing'.
